Transaction: fe25efab569cf2d307b1e8f82b3e4ea9f178300a6207e9cf49e68504322cf8c2

Block Hash: 03407a0967cbc743e1f198f2d267cc4aad1dfc81a5c11864d03aa1a3777bde80

Confirmations: 2608005

Timestamp: 2018-06-18 19:06:42

Amount: 18.644705000000002

Is Block Reward: No

Inputs

Sender Address Amount
SSPKXAq2pfvYj3H89WpwUQBJ5GuWKWNePJ 18.51

Outputs

Recipient Address Amount
SSPKXAq2pfvYj3H89WpwUQBJ5GuWKWNePJ 18.644705000000002